This Dublin pub is delivering freshly pulled pints of Guinness during the coronavirus pandemic

A DUBLIN pub is doing its bit to help keep spirits up during the coronavirus outbreak with a door-to-door Guinness delivery service. 

Graingers Hanlons Corner on the North Circular Road has proven a hit with drinkers missing the pub but eager to adhere to Ireland’s strict lockdown measures. 

For the past week or so, the Dublin bar has been delivering freshly-pulled pints of Guinness along with other beers, wines, bottles and cans to a thirsty, housebound public. 

They also stock cigarettes and other pub favourites for anyone looking to recreate the magic of a good Irish boozer from the comfort of their front room or garden. 

Staff are pulling out all the stops to stay safe too, with each and every delivery adhering to social distancing rules and hygiene rules. 

Graingers Hanlons Corner first alerted fans to their Guinness delivery service plans via Facebook. 

"We here at Graingers Hanlons Corner will deliver a freshly pulled pint of Guinness or any pint of your choice and deliver to your door!” they wrote. 

"Health restrictions apply! You must collect from car door and will be served in a pint sized plastic glass! 

"Call us today and order your wine, cans and bottles of beer and cigarettes for home delivery on 018384181 or 0872379014." 

Their efforts have since gone viral, with fans across the capital taking advantage of the service to enjoy a perfectly poured pint of the black stuff – an increasingly rare commodity in these new restricted times. 

It’s proven a hit too, with the pub and off-licence estimating it has delivered an astonishing 150 to 180 pints a day. 

On top of that, Graingers Hanlons Corner is also doing its level best to keep the local community fed, with a special dial-a-meal service for anyone in need of food.
